Distometer (or Vertex Distance) gauge is designed
to accurately measure the vertex distance between the cornea and trial lens, or
cornea and rear surface of the spectacle Rx lens. The Conversion Disc is used to
convert any combination of lens power and vertex distance into an equivalent
lens power for a different distance.
Normally a trial lens is placed 5mm to 20mm from
the cornea. Spectacle Rx, when fitted correctly, should be between 8mm and 12mm
from the cornea. Any difference, however, in vertex distance between the trial
lenses and the resultant spectacle Rx produces an error in the effective power
of the correction.
The combination of these two devices permits the
examiner to measure and then move between any combinations of cornea distance
and lens power.
For example, a +12.00D trial lens at 19mm from
the cornea must be increased to a +13.00D if placed 11mm from the cornea. As a
second example, a -15.00D lens at 15mm vertex distance must be decreased to a
-13.00D if placed at 6mm.
The conversion disc supports conversion from a
particular combination employed with a trial lens set-up to an equivalent
combination in a spectacle Rx. The outer ring shows the lens power (D) and the
inner scale shows the + and - lens power, as indicated on each side
respectively.
Example:
+15.00D at 12mm = +16.50 D at 6 mm
